GEM was awarded 3 new H2020 projects from the Fuel Cells & Hydrogen Joint Undertaking funding programme in the 2018 Call:
- as a project partner in ‘AD ASTRA’ on Accelerated Testing methodologies on solid oxide materials (2019-2021)
- as Coordinator of ‘WASTE2GRIDS’ on modelling Grid Balancing Plants based on waste streams and fuel cells (2019-2020)
- as Coordinator of ‘WASTE2WATTS’ on valorising the EU biogas potential in solid oxide fuel cells (2019-2020)
The total budget in the 3 projects amounts to 5.2 M€ and the EPFL-GEM share to 846 k€.
